A Community-Driven Clean-Up and Beautification Effort
Overview:
Twice a year, neighborhood volunteers gather for scheduled workdays to maintain and beautify Bill Craft Park. These events bring together neighbors and friends who share a commitment to keeping their local park clean, safe, and inviting.
Project Goals:
Volunteer activities include mulching, pruning, and general cleanup of the park, including removing dead branches and small trees. Occasionally, City of Greensboro staff assist with these efforts. Volunteers also fund and plant shrubs and trees to enhance the park’s landscape.
Community Impact:
The ongoing beautification of Bill Craft Park helps create a welcoming public space that strengthens neighborhood pride and provides a place for families to gather and play.
